Syracuse (WSYR-TV) - Many Time Warner customers have noticed a sudden change to their network lineups.

Several popular channels are no longer available and Central New Yorkers are wondering why.

The company says it notified customers in September that, in mid-October, Time Warner Cable would move them to what it calls a higher-quality, digital-only experience.

They say 80 percent of Time Warner’s customers who subscribe to digital cable won’t notice a difference.

Those who do not subscribe to digital cable will no longer have access to those channels being offered exclusively through a digital format.

The list includes:
  • CMT
  • C-SPAN
  • EWTN
  • The Golf Channel
  • Lifetime Movie Network
  • OWN
  • Tru-TV
To continue receiving these channels digitally, customers will need either a cable box, a digital adapter, or a cable card.
